The GTM Challenge

Most product launches fail not because of bad products, but because of bad go-to-market execution. Without deep market research, teams make critical positioning, pricing, and channel decisions based on assumptions.

Positioning Guesswork

Without comprehensive competitive analysis, differentiation claims are often wrong—or worse, irrelevant to buyers.

Channel Uncertainty

Which channels will actually reach your target buyers? Traditional research takes longer than your launch timeline.

Pricing Blind Spots

Pricing too high loses deals. Pricing too low leaves money on the table. Both require market intelligence you don't have time to gather.
